Once the bands started, the time seemed to be going much faster and really soon, White Lies was on the stage, making some girls in front of us who came from Switzerland really happy! For me, White Lies are just like Franz Ferdinand. I mean, they didn’t catch my attention when I listened to the CD (seemed boring even), but live they were really cool! Sure, I only knew a couple of songs, but they had a very good set. Haven’t seen them live when they came here, but now I’d definitely go if only they came again. Maybe this time it won’t rain as bad as the last time :)

Setlist:

  1. Farewell To The Fairground
  2. Strangers
  3. To Lose My Life
  4. Holy Ghost
  5. The Price Of Love
  6. A Place To Hide
  7. Death
  8. Unfinished Business
  9. The Power & The Glory
  10. Bigger Than Us

Kaiser Cheifs were next and just like White Lies, I haven’t seen them when they played here. And I didn’t like them much on the CD either. But my god, were they fun! I don’t know if Ricky Wilson is that hyper all the time, or he was sort of drunk (his face was kinda red :lol: ) but they put on such a great show!  I knew about five songs they played, Ruby being the most fun, I was jumping a lot, half trying to make people to move away from me. At one point, towards the end, Ricky jumped off the stage, went to one of the bars nearby and started giving people beer, it was hilarious. Also, people went nuts when they thought Hayley and Jeremy from Paramore were watching Kaiser Chiefs, but actually, it was just Jeremy and his girlfriend. But from that moment on, I couldn’t pay attention to them anymore since I realized that OMG I’M GONNA SEE PARAMORE!

Setlist:

  1. Everyday I Love You Less and Less
  2. Little Shocks
  3. Never Miss A Beat
  4. Modern Way
  5. Long Way From Celebrating
  6. Ruby
  7. Starts With Nothing
  8. I Predict a Riot
  9. Take My Temperature
  10. Kinda Girl You Are
  11. The Angry Mob
  12. Oh My God

Setlist:

  1. Intro
  2. Ignorance
  3. Feeling Sorry
  4. That’s What You Get
  5. For A Pessimist, I’m Pretty Optimistic
  6. Emergency
  7. Playing God
  8. Crushcrushcrush
  9. Monster
  10. Pressure
  11. Looking Up
  12. The Only Exception
  13. Brick By Boring Brick
  14. Misery Business
